Description
Top left - annotated 'RAAF, AUST 409343, Sgt Pilot Tillotson G K, Gardner Street, Box-Hill E11, Victoria, Australia'.
Bottom left - photograph of a woman wearing dress sitting on a wall. Top right - photograph of a baby in a toy car.
Bottom right - newspaper cutting headline 'Five nationalities at Wellingborough party'. Details of party with New Zealand, Australian, Canadian, American and British all in uniform held in home of Mrs Clark, hostess for dominion troops. Far right - annotated 'Sept D.F.C. Jan 44 Flying Officer'.

FIVE NATIONALITIES AT WELLINGBOROUGH PARTY
Five nationalities will be represented at a party at Wellingborough this evening (Saturday) – New Zealand, Australian, Canadian, American and British – and every representative will be entitled to wear uniform. The party will be held at the home of Mrs. Clark, a hostess for Dominion troops, of 16, Hatton-avenue.
Other hostesses for Dominion troops at Wellingborough are Mrs. A.R. Woolley, of "The Elms," Hatton Park-road, and Mrs. H.B. Groome, of 62, Hatton Park-road.
